+import fnmatch
+import os
+
+import pytest
+
+
+class TestUpgradepkg:
+ @pytest.mark.complete("upgradepkg -")
+ def test_1(self, completion):
+ assert completion
+
+ @pytest.mark.complete("upgradepkg --")
+ def test_2(self, completion):
+ assert (
+ completion == "--dry-run --install-new --reinstall "
+ "--verbose".split()
+ )
+
+ @pytest.mark.complete("upgradepkg ", cwd="slackware/home")
+ def test_4(self, completion):
+ expected = sorted(
+ [
+ "%s/" % x
+ for x in os.listdir("slackware/home")
+ if os.path.isdir("./slackware/home/%s" % x)
+ ]
+ + [
+ x
+ for x in os.listdir("slackware/home")
+ if os.path.isfile("./slackware/home/%s" % x)
+ and fnmatch.fnmatch(x, "*.t[bglx]z")
+ ]
+ )
+ assert completion == expected
+
+ @pytest.mark.complete("upgradepkg foo%", cwd="slackware/home")
+ def test_after_percent(self, completion):
+ expected = sorted(
+ [
+ "%s/" % x
+ for x in os.listdir("slackware/home")
+ if os.path.isdir("./slackware/home/%s" % x)
+ ]
+ + [
+ x
+ for x in os.listdir("slackware/home")
+ if os.path.isfile("./slackware/home/%s" % x)
+ and fnmatch.fnmatch(x, "*.t[bglx]z")
+ ]
+ )
+ assert completion == ["foo%%%s" % x for x in expected]
